The Opportunity
When you join PwC Acceleration Centers (ACs), you step into a pivotal role focused on actively supporting various Acceleration Center services, from Advisory to Assurance, Tax and Business Services. In our innovative hubs, you’ll engage in challenging projects and provide distinctive services to support client engagements through enhanced quality and innovation. You’ll also participate in dynamic and digitally enabled training that is designed to grow your technical and professional skills.
As part of the Talent and Development team you will serve as a trusted advisor, accelerating the development of our people while collaborating with leaders to enhance our people strategy. As a Senior Associate, you will guide and mentor others, navigating complex challenges to build meaningful client relationships and foster an inclusive culture. This role offers a dynamic environment where you will leverage your coaching skills and contribute to diversity initiatives, promoting the growth and satisfaction of our talent.
Responsibilities
- Act as a trusted advisor to enhance talent development strategies
- Mentor and guide team members through complex challenges
- Build and maintain meaningful relationships with clients and stakeholders
- Contribute to initiatives promoting diversity and inclusion within the organization
- Utilize coaching skills to foster professional growth among peers
- Navigate ambiguity while delivering impactful solutions
- Collaborate with leadership to align people strategies with business goals
- Support the continuous enhancement of talent development programs
What You Must Have
- Bachelor's Degree
- 4 years of experience
- Oral and written proficiency in English required
What Sets You Apart
- MBA Degree
- Demonstrated knowledge of coaching and talent development
- Proven ability in performance management and employee relations
- Experience in managing diversity initiatives
- Collaborating effectively with business leaders
- Building and maintaining professional relationships
- Supporting onboarding and offboarding processes
- Advising on workforce planning and skill acquisition
- Understanding HR policy interpretation
